### Canary gate stuck at 5%

If a Pinemarsh canary deploy refuses to advance past the 5% stage, check the gating rules in the Oakline policy file first: the error-rate gate compares against a seven-day baseline, so a quiet weekend baseline can make normal weekday traffic look anomalous. Confirm the baseline window in the gate summary, then inspect the blocked-metrics list. If the gate is healthy but frozen, manually query the gate evaluator endpoint, which requires authenticating with the bearer token below.

session JWT of yawep-yawep = eyJhbGciOiJIUzI1NiIsInR5cCI6IkpXVCJ9.eyJzdWIiOiI3pWF3_In0.aXYsHiog

## Runbook: Tidemark Widget — Stale Data

Symptom: widget shows yesterday's tide table or blank chart.

1. Check the Harborline feed job; it runs every 6h. If the last run failed, rerun manually.
2. Purge the widget cache — stale entries persist up to 24h otherwise.
3. If the chart renders but times are shifted, the timezone table is outdated; redeploy config.
4. Still broken: roll back to last known-good release.

The current production build is pinned below.

session token of yajof-bagef = htk4_937d

**Ticket: Signature check fails on Larkspur flag bundles**

Several plugin authors report that flag-definition bundles for the Larkspur rollout framework fail verification after the 3.1 update. Cause: the bundle manifest format changed, and old verifier builds reject the new header. Upgrade your verifier to 3.1.2 and re-verify against the current key, reproduced here.

signing key of bagap-yawep = bky13_TbfT6ZMUoGJo2

Subject: Quickstore 4.2 — bloom filter now fronts the KV layer

Plugin authors: starting with this release, Quickstore places a bloom filter ahead of the key-value store. Negative lookups return faster; false positives fall through safely. No API changes are required on your side. Verify your plugin against the staging build referenced below.

session token of fahif-tadup = htk3_9c7